ru·bi·cund    Audio Help   [roo-bi-kuhnd] Pronunciation Key
–adjective
red or reddish; ruddy: a rubicund complexion.

[Origin: 1495–1505; < L rubicundus, akin to ruber red1]

ru·bi·cun·di·ty, noun

Main Entry:  rubicund
Part of Speech:  adjective
Synonyms:  colored, florid, flushed, healthy, red, rosy, ruddy, reddish, rubescent
